首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

列出测试,但不运行它们

测试是软件开发过程中的一项重要环节,通过对软件系统进行测试,可以发现和修复潜在的缺陷和问题,确保软件的质量和稳定性。测试可以分为多个层次和类型,包括单元测试、集成测试、系统测试、性能测试、安全测试等。

  1. 单元测试:单元测试是对软件系统中最小的可测试单元进行测试,通常是对函数、方法或模块进行测试。单元测试可以帮助开发人员验证代码的正确性,提高代码的可维护性和可重用性。腾讯云提供的产品中,云函数(https://cloud.tencent.com/product/scf)可以用于部署和运行单元测试。
  2. 集成测试:集成测试是将多个单元测试组合在一起进行测试,验证不同模块之间的交互和协作是否正常。腾讯云提供的产品中,云开发(https://cloud.tencent.com/product/tcb)可以帮助开发人员进行集成测试和部署。
  3. 系统测试:系统测试是对整个软件系统进行测试,验证系统的功能、性能、稳定性等是否符合需求和预期。腾讯云提供的产品中,云服务器(https://cloud.tencent.com/product/cvm)可以用于部署和运行系统测试。
  4. 性能测试:性能测试是对软件系统的性能进行评估和测试,包括响应时间、并发用户数、吞吐量等指标。腾讯云提供的产品中,云压测(https://cloud.tencent.com/product/cts)可以帮助开发人员进行性能测试和评估。
  5. 安全测试:安全测试是对软件系统的安全性进行评估和测试,包括漏洞扫描、渗透测试等。腾讯云提供的产品中,云安全中心(https://cloud.tencent.com/product/ssc)可以帮助开发人员进行安全测试和评估。

总结:测试是软件开发过程中不可或缺的环节,通过不同类型的测试可以发现和修复软件系统中的问题和缺陷,提高软件的质量和稳定性。腾讯云提供了一系列与测试相关的产品,包括云函数、云开发、云服务器、云压测和云安全中心,可以帮助开发人员进行各种类型的测试和评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JVM - 列出JVM默认参数及运行时生效参数

以后提供了几个参数可以打印出来所有XX参数和对应的值 -XX:+PrintFlagsInitial 表示打印出所有参数选项的默认值 -XX:+PrintFlagsFinal 表示打印出所有参数选项在运行程序时生效的值...执行的话 java -XX:+PrintFlagsInitial java -XX:+PrintFlagsFinal ---- -XX:+PrintFlagsInitial 列出JVM参数的默认值...第一列表示参数的数据类型 第二列是名称 第三列”=”表示第四列是参数的默认值,如果是”:=” 表明了参数被用户或者JVM赋值了 第四列为值 第五列是参数的类别 ---- -XX:+PrintFlagsFinal 列出运行程序时生效的值...---- -XX:+PrintCommandLineFlags 列出被用户或者JVM优化设置过的详细的XX参数的名称和值 这一步其实就是列出 -XX:+PrintFlagsFinal的结果中第三列有":...UnlockExperimentalVMOptions 解锁实验参数 -XX:+UnlockInternalVMOptions 解锁内部参数 这个就是隐藏副本了 ,愿君多留意~ ---- jinfo 查看正在运行

4.7K20
  • AB测试是好,但不适合创新

    测试过程中,随机选取一定数量的用户(如客户,访客),将其分成对照组或测试组,然后测量这两个组的行为有何差异。...A/B测试提供的是一种渐进式思维方式:通过比较找到更好的方案,而不是通过失败慢慢靠近自己的愿景。这种渐进式方法能够达到优化的目的,但不利于创新。 过度依赖A/B测试会使人短视。...这也会增加A/B测试的复杂度—一般来说“纯” A /B测试只能测试一个变量,从而可以建立明确的因果关系。 在早期,初创企业经常遇到的另一个问题是数据不够。...然而,某些产品特点很难衡量其短期提升,但从长远来看,忽略它们又会带来负面影响。这些包括质量和用户“喜好”,还包括隐私、安全性和可访问性。...在这种情况下,需要注意几个方面: 首先,不同于常规A/B 测试,你对产品进行了重大改进,你对一系列的变动进行测试,我们应该给这类测试起一个别的名字。在8fit,我们叫“影响力测试”。

    45630

    如何在 Linux 中列出 Systemd 下所有正在运行的服务

    在本指南[1]中,我们将演示如何在 Linux 中列出 systemd 下所有正在运行的服务。...在 Linux 中列出 SystemD 下正在运行的服务 当您运行不带任何参数的 systemctl 命令时,它将显示所有加载的 systemd 单元的列表(阅读 systemd 文档以获取有关 systemd...单元的更多信息),包括服务,显示它们的状态(无论是否处于活动状态)。...systemctl 要列出系统上所有已加载的服务(无论是活动的、正在运行的、退出的还是失败的,请使用 list-units 子命令和带有服务值的 --type 开关。...# systemctl list-units --type=service OR # systemctl --type=service 要列出所有已加载但处于活动状态的服务,包括正在运行的和已退出的服务

    28120

    JavaScript——请列出目前主流的 JavaScript 模块化实现的技术有哪些?说出它们的区别?

    伴随着NodeJS的兴起,能让JS在任何地方运行,特别是服务端,也达到了具备开发大型项目的能力,所以CommonJS营运而生。...,不会污染全局作用域 模块可以多次加载,但只会在第一次加载时候运行,然后运行结果就被缓存了,以后再加载,就直接读取缓存结果 模块加载顺讯,按照代码出现的顺序同步加载 __dirname代表当前文件所在的文件夹路径...ES6的模块不是对象,import命令会被 JavaScript 引擎静态分析,在编译时就引入模块代码,而不是在代码运行时加载,所以无法实现条件加载。也正因为这个,使得静态分析成为可能。...AMD规范采用异步方式加载模块,模块的加载不影响它后面语句的运行。所有依赖这个模块的语句,都定义在一个回调函数中,等到加载完成之后,这个回调函数才会运行。...运行原理 UMD先判断是否支持Node.js的模块(exports)是否存在,存在则使用Node.js模块模式。 再判断是否支持AMD(define是否存在),存在则使用AMD方式加载模块。

    15210

    软件测试基础知识 – 集成测试和系统测试的区别,以及它们的应用场景

    请点击http://www.captainbed.net 区别 1、测试计划和测试用例编制的先后顺序:从V模型来讲,在需求阶段就要制定系统测试计划和测试用例,概要设计的时候做集成测试计划和测试用例,有些公司的具体实践不一样...,但是顺序肯定是先做系统测试计划和测试用例,再做集成测试计划和测试用例。...2、测试用例的粒度:系统测试用例相对很接近用户接受的测试用例,集成测试用例比系统测试用例更详细,而且对于接口部分要重点编写,毕竟要集成各个模块或者子系统。...3、执行测试的顺序:先执行集成测试,待集成测试出的问题修复之后,再做系统测试。...集成测试测试人员的编写脚本能力要求比较高。测试方法一般选用黑盒测试和白盒测试相结合的方法。

    1K30

    成功的测试通常是运行测试用例后_成功的测试是指运行测试用例后

    大家好,又见面了,我是你们的朋友全栈君 前言 用过pytest的小伙伴都知道,pytest的运行方式是非常丰富的,可以说是你想怎么运行怎么运行,想运行哪些运行哪些,那httprunner是否同样可以呢...运行用例的各种方式 运行指定路径的用例 格式:hrun + case路径 (httprunner_env) ➜ hrun hrun hrun_demo/testcases/baidu_test.py...=============================================================================================== 指定多个测试用例路径执行...YAML/JSON格式的测试用例 如果运行YAML/JSON文件,其实httprunner会先把它们转换为pytest格式的,再去运行。...然而,如果测试用例目录名或用例文件名包含. - 空格这些字符,这些字符将被_替换,以避免python类中用例引用时的语法错误。

    99130

    teprunner测试平台测试计划批量运行用例

    本文开发内容 上一篇文章已经把pytest引入到测试平台中,通过多线程和多进程的方式,运行测试用例。有了这个基础,做批量运行用例的功能就很简单了,只需要前端传入一个CaseList即可。...具体开发内容如下: 测试计划增删改查 测试计划动态添加移除测试用例 运行测试计划,批量运行用例 计划运行结果、用例运行结果 编写后端代码 编辑teprunner/urls.py文件,添加测试计划的路由:...plan.case_result和case.case_result类似,返回测试计划的每条用例的运行结果。...主路由用来展示计划运行结果,子路由用来展示用例运行结果(包含了日志输出)。跳转代码是: ? 和测试计划主页面方式一样,用到了this.$router.push()。...小结 本文进一步完善了测试平台的功能,除了单条用例运行,还能批量用例运行(催更的小伙伴可以拉代码尝试下哦)。

    80010

    使用 Maven 运行单元测试

    created rolebinding.rbac.authorization.k8s.io/java-gitlab-runner created 创建成功之后,打开页面 /admin/runners,会看到其中列出了我们新建的...Runner 运行起来之后,我们可以尝试建立一个项目,使用 Runner 来针对每次提交,运行一次单元测试。 访问 projects/new 创建一个新项目,命名为 sample: ?...这表示项目的 CICD 正在运行。...如果我们修改一下测试案例 src/test/java/com/example/project/CalculatorTests.java,把其中的 34 行修改为 1011 或者其它的错误结果,就会看到测试失败的情况...如果新建分支,并在分支中修复测试案例的话,会在 MR 中看到单元测试的结果,帮助管理员判断 Merge Request 的合并请求是否合理: ?

    1.8K10

    软件测试|Pycharm运行与调试

    Pycharm作为集成开发环境,除了可以编写脚本,还可以运行和调试自己的代码,下面就为大家介绍一下pycharm运行和调试代码的功能如何使用。...代码运行编写好我们的代码之后,我们肯定是需要去运行的,pycharm提供了几种运行代码的方式,主要有以下几种方式。...右键Run运行直接在要运行的py文件中右键,点击Run即可, 或者使用快捷键Ctrl + Shift + F10图片导航栏Run执行图片如果之前执行过某个程序,在这里是可以看到的,选择要执行的程序,点击绿色的三角形即可运行...Workding directory:项目路径通过入口函数启动运行如果程序中有入口函数,会在左侧有个绿色的小三角形,点击选择Run 项目名即可启动图片上述3种方式都能成功运行脚本,输出九九乘法表。...图片代码调试DebugBug大家都知道是程序中的错误,bug的存在导致程序不能正常运行。而DeBug的字面意思就是解决Bug。代码调试的方式与运行脚本的方式类似,主要也是三种方法。

    1.3K10

    设置 PostgreSQL 以运行集成测试

    至少,这意味着每个测试都应该有自己的数据库。这可确保测试不会相互干扰,并且您可以并行运行测试而不会出现任何问题。性能– 我们希望确保为测试设置 PostgreSQL 的速度很快。...对于在 CI/CD 管道中运行测试来说,缓慢的解决方案将导致成本过高。我们提出的解决方案必须允许我们在不引入太多开销的情况下执行测试。...使用 时pg_tmp,启动和填充数据库需要几秒钟的时间,并且当运行数千个测试时,这种开销会迅速增加。假设您有 1000 个测试,每个测试需要 1 秒来运行。...管理测试数据库基本思想是在运行测试之前创建一个模板数据库,然后为每个测试从模板数据库创建一个新数据库。...该destroy方法可用于在测试运行后清理数据库。结论这种设置允许我们在多个分片上并行运行数千个测试,而不会出现任何问题。创建新数据库的开销很小,并且隔离是在数据库级别的。

    8910

    PyTest运行指定的测试

    帮忙多点点文章末右下角的“好看”支持下,也可以将本文分享到朋友圈或你身边的朋友,谢谢 在PyTest中,提供了几种从命令行运行指定的测试集方式。...方式一,文件/模块级运行,即指定运行某一.py文件,在命令行下: 命令格式: pytest 文件名.py > pytest xxxx.py 即,直接用pytest 文件名即可,运行该py文件中所有的测试用例...方式二,目录级运行,即指定运行某一目录下所有测试集方式,在命令行下: 命令格式: pytest 目录名 > pytest testing/ 注: testing为目录 方式三,指定运行某个模块中的某个测试用例...,在命令行下 命令格式:pytest 文件名.py::测试方法 > pytest test_file::test_case test_file,为.py文件 test_case, 为test_file.py...中的一个测试用例 方式四,指定运行某个模块中的测试类的测试用例, 在命令行中如下 命令格式:pytest 文件名.py::测试类::测试方法 > pytest test_file::TestSuite:

    7.3K40

    停止使用CICD工具运行测试

    许多 CI/CD 工具依赖插件来支持特定的测试工具/版本——这并不能保证一致性。它们的后备通常是某种脚本环境,这可能会完成这项工作,但会增加复杂性和维护开销,从而难以扩展和多样化测试工作。 2....虽然它们可能允许启动不同的“工作进程”,但与测试工具相关的逻辑必须通过自定义脚本和/或第三方解决方案来管理。 5....它们可能提供查看每个单独测试的日志/工件输出,但汇总质量指标(如通过/失败率和执行次数)并不是它们的重点。...访问特定测试执行结果和工件以深入故障排除通常需要编写大量脚本或将它们导出到外部工具进行进一步分析。 6....这些管道可以在需要时运行,但单个测试不能运行。 所有测试结果都可以在这些管道的输出中找到,但如果使用多个测试工具,它们仍然会断开连接。

    8510
    领券